Minutes — Management Meeting (Finance Team)

Present: Okafor, Brandt, Liesl.

Decision: hedge 70% of the lira exposure on the Dunmarsh contract via six-month forwards. Options rejected on cost. Brandt to execute by Friday; Liesl to update the exposure ledger. Next review in four weeks. The confidential rationale is recorded below.

board note of bafog-taduf: Gross margin on Oliath came in at 5 percent against a plan of 5 percent. Only 9 of the 120 pilot accounts renewed Oliath, so a churn review is set for January 15.

TURN-208: Gatevale turnstile counters at the Merrow Field pilot double-count when a rotation reverses mid-cycle. Attendance totals drift roughly 2% high per event. The debounce window fix is implemented, reviewed by Ilsa, and soak-tested across two simulated match days without drift. Ready for your cut; the candidate build is identified below.

trace token, tagag-tafog: htk6_5ed18c

**Handover: Greenspire donation-receipt mailer**

Taking over from Arlen. Notes for plugin authors: the mailer renders receipts through the Thistlewick template engine; plugins may register custom footer blocks but must not override the amount-formatting hook — it's locked for compliance. Retries are handled by the queue, so don't implement your own. Sandbox sends go to a capture inbox, never real donors. Test against the sandbox environment only. The sandbox mailer runs with the configuration values listed below.

config for kagup-hahig:
druwyn:
  pin: 2801
  metrics_host: metrics.druwyn.zemvarlabs.internal
  tenant: sorius
  seal: seal_798a43d7

Finance Review Summary — Q2 Cash-Flow Forecast

For the incoming director: the Q2 forecast for Ardenfall Systems shows a stable cash position, with inflows from the Westhollow maintenance contracts covering the planned capital spend on the Norbeck facility. The main sensitivity is the timing of the Cravens Group settlement. No covenant concerns at present. The confidential note on forward business plans is set out immediately below.

internal memo for yahag-tahog: The pricing group signed off on a budget of $152.8 million for Project Soriel.